Output 510856e5feffea3a7cf666f66dc0ceeae04f6338b8adb06d6354eb05b66c076e:16

value
998468
script pubkey
OP_0 OP_PUSHBYTES_20 70bb7c20d61e702bc5ff2bd43338c6f59c5db6f1
address
bc1qwzahcgxkreczh30l902rxwxx7kw9mdh3hvvhg7
transaction
510856e5feffea3a7cf666f66dc0ceeae04f6338b8adb06d6354eb05b66c076e
spent
true